I have a page on which I want to display several sections each of which
contain a list of names. I have two database tables, one of which contains
the section headings, and the other contains the names and which section
they belong to. I would like to use databinding to display this information,
preferably using DataLists. However, because the number of sections will
vary, the DataLists will need to be added dynamically. But because DataLists
use templates, I do not know how to do this. All of the DataLists will have
identical templates, but I do not know how to create the template when the
DataList is added dynamically. Can someone help me here? Thanks.
